PYPL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2021 in Review

2,608 of the 6,499 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in PayPal (PYPL) for Q4 2021, worth a combined $168B — down 41% from $287B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 396 funds opened new PYPL positions and 279 closed out — a net gain of 117 holders — while 1,195 added to existing stakes and 814 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Edgewood Management, adding an estimated $982M. The largest seller was Capital World Investors, cutting an estimated $2.95B.
